Output 87991dd43359cebd7ec8f750b13fef9ae5eec0d93d203b2a3056cf2e0725d03a:0

value
511456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ae722923c55ca0db3f203c102d51e09c130f93e7 OP_EQUAL
address
3HbQFwsaBSdcjUVe4EREwdnKTuzLiXXFQM
transaction
87991dd43359cebd7ec8f750b13fef9ae5eec0d93d203b2a3056cf2e0725d03a
confirmations
356948
spent
true